3 RepliesIMO the best way to fix this is: 1. Get rid of the boons completely, and just make it to where you automatically have a mercy and only have to make it to 7 wins to go flawless. This removes a system that is kinda stupid since most people just delete their card if they lose before their 5th win anyways. 2. Make people that have already gone flawless on that character only play against people that are also flawless that week. Meaning after you go flawless on all three of your characters then you will only be put up against flawless teams. This removes two of the biggest complaints that most people have with trials in its current rendition. There are less people that can just be straight out carried because streamers/carriers can only carry three people. This also alleviates the problem of people unable to go flawless. With the new system, everybody will be able to go flawless with enough persistence. Now I can already hear the complaints that trials is only supposed to be for the "hardcore" player, but things need to change. Trials participation is down almost 50 percent since the launch of ROI, and that number is steadily decreasing, and will soon begin to spiral. Players like myself that are good, but not top tier will soon start to fall off as the competition becomes even more stiff. Hopefully with changes like the ones above we can keep the community healthier, longer. [spoiler]TLDR trials needs a few changes where it's still competitive, but average/above average players have a better chance, or the game will die even faster. [/spoiler]

I'm an average PVPer, but I used to run trials most weekends for bounties. In year two you could get a decent trials weapon like the Glass Promontory or the Doctrine of passing from the gold bounty, it just wasn't Adept. So we got to enjoy using new guns, and the elite players were still identifiable by their Adept versions. Now in year three as all I can get is year two armor for bounties, I have less motivation to suffer being pub-stomped at the hands of the elite. If bungie made bounty rewards more current again I think more average players would return.
